Module: Pubnub::Client::Events
- Included in:
- Pubnub::Client
- Defined in:
- lib/pubnub/client/events.rb
Overview
Module that holds generator for all events
Constant Summary collapse
- EVENTS =
%w[publish subscribe presence leave history fetch_messages here_now audit grant grant_token revoke_token delete_messages revoke time heartbeat where_now set_state state channel_registration message_counts signal add_message_action get_message_actions remove_message_action add_channels_to_push list_push_provisions remove_channels_from_push remove_device_from_push set_uuid_metadata set_channel_metadata remove_uuid_metadata remove_channel_metadata get_uuid_metadata get_all_uuid_metadata get_channel_metadata get_all_channels_metadata get_channel_members get_memberships set_channel_members set_memberships remove_memberships remove_channel_members].freeze
Instance Method Summary collapse
Instance Method Details
#fire(options, &block) ⇒ Object
41 42 43 |
# File 'lib/pubnub/client/events.rb', line 41 def fire(, &block) publish(.merge(store: false, replicate: false), &block) end |